Trip Type: Family Review 1 of 11Great Stay
We loved the Taos Inn. It was conveniently located in the Historic District and allowed lots of walking. The room was very comfortable and the working fireplace was lovely. The restaurant food was excellent and we enjoyed the nightly entertainment. I would definitely recommend this inn to anyone going to visit Taos.

Trip Type: Not Provided Review 8 of 11Excellent hotel and great location
This is an excellent hotel and right across the street from the Taos Plaza. Room was very clean and well laid out, but a touch small. The restaurant (Doc Martin's) and bar (Adobe Bar) in the lobby are also very nice. Highly recommended!

Trip Type: Not Provided Review 9 of 11History and Serenity
Lovely old hotel in the heart of Taos. Within walking distance to the plaza and other restaurants. "Adobe Bar" is quaint with live music. (The group "South by Southwest" was fun!) Good food and service at the adjoining "Doc Martin's" restaurant. Summer fun is driving to the ski area and taking the chair lift for spectacular views. Check-out was a bit of a problem. Keep your hotel.com email receipt. All in all, an enjoyable place to stay in historic Taos.
